- In an assessment for intermittent claudication, the cardiac-vascular nurse assesses the leg pain and cramping with exertion, then asks the patient: 
 
A. "Does the shortness of breath accompany the leg pain?" 
B. "Does this same type of pain occur without activity?" 
C. "Is the leg pain relieved by rest?" 
D. "Is the leg pain relieved with elevation?" - Answer- C. "Is the leg pain relieved by rest?"

- The examination of a patient in a supine position reveals distended jugular veins from the base of the neck to the angle of the jaw. This finding indicates: 
decreased venous return. 
increased central venous pressure. 
increased pulmonary artery capillary pressure. 
left-sided heart failure. - Answer- increased central venous pressure.
